Kiállította is a Hungarian verb form meaning either “exhibited” or “issued,” depending on context. It is the third-person singular past tense form of the verb kiállít, which has two main senses: to display or present something publicly, and to issue a document, certificate, invoice, or other official item. The exact meaning of kiállította is determined by the surrounding words, especially the object of the verb.
